Ground Floor

Porch Double timber folding doors open into a granite built porch with the house name displayed on a miniature millstone below a pitched slate roof with a profusion of fruiting passion flower over. Window to the side and door to:

Sitting Room18'10\" x 17'1\" (5.74m x 5.2m). Timber beams and rustic tiled floor, millstone table and artefacts, two hardwood double glazed windows to the front aspect, stable door to the side aspect opening to the porch, built-in cupboard to the rear and stairs to the first floor.

Kitchen / Diner23'5\" x 15'1\" (7.14m x 4.6m). Ceramic tiled floor, beamed ceiling, space for table and chairs, Aga in a granite chimney breast to one side, two windows to the front aspect and double glazed French doors opening onto the patio and the garden beyond. An impressive millstone table stands in front of a range of floor standing wooden fronted cupboards below a ceramic tiled work surface, with inset double bowl stainless steel sink and mixer tap. A range of cupboards and display units, ceiling spot lights and space for an electric cooker.

Utility Area Double glazed roof window, vinyl flooring, built-in cupboards, space for washing machine, Belfast sink. Tiled splash-backs, built-in cupboard to the rear, with shelving and useful storage space. Downstairs cloaks/WC. A stable door opens from the utility area to a sheltered porch housing the former mill wheel and providing a useful storage / drying area.

First Floor

Landing Two double glazed windows to the rear aspect, two double fronted storage cupboards, pine panelled ceiling with exposed beams, doors off to:

Bedroom One18'10\" x 14'11\" (5.74m x 4.55m). Double glazed window to the side aspect looking out onto the gardens and ponds in the distance, two further windows to the front aspect.

Bedroom Two11'7\" x 10'9\" (3.53m x 3.28m). Double glazed window to the front aspect, built-in wardrobe and loft access.

Bathroom Part tiled floor, three piece in white comprising close coupled WC, pedestal wash hand basin, bath with electric shower over and double glazed window to the front aspect.

Bedroom Three15'9\" x 10'6\" (4.8m x 3.2m). Two double glazed windows to the front aspect, some exposed beams and tall window to the side aspect, built-in wardrobes.

Outside Crean Mill stands in its own gardens and enjoys the use of further grounds leased at an annual cost currently £300. From a porch resplendant with fruiting passion flower, various paths lead on beyond the lawned garden and trail through areas of established tender planting, shrubs and small trees into woodlands, becoming progressively wilder the further one walks from the mill. There are two ponds fed by a stream in which otters have been sighted. A large workshop and a greenhouse are also sited in the grounds. The gardens are a real feature of the property - a tremendous habitat for wildlife and of massive appeal to conservationists and gardeners.
